BANGOR, Maine (WABI) - What a beautiful day we had today! High temps reached the 70s and 80s with sunny skies and comfy dewpoints. Tonight, low temps will drop down from the mid 50s to low 60s. Skies will be mostly clear with comfy/slightly sticky dewpoints. This will allow for patchy fog to develop into the early AM hours. SSW gusts will reach 15 mph overnight. A cold front will start to enter Northern Maine during the early AM hours, so scattered showers are expected by sunrise up North.
The back half of our weekend will provide Maine with some much-needed rainfall and temperature relief.
